C T Online Desk: Shakhawat Sabbir | Special Correspondent : The chiefs of Bangladesh’s Army, Navy, and Air Force paid a courtesy call on Chief Adviser Professor Muhammad Yunus on Friday, marking the observance of Armed Forces Day 2025.
According to the Deputy Press Secretary to the Chief Adviser, Abul Kalam Azad Majumder, the meeting took place in the morning at the Armed Forces Division in Dhaka Cantonment. Army Chief General Waker-Uz-Zaman, Navy Chief Admiral M Nazmul Hassan, and Air Force Chief Air Chief Marshal Hasan Mahmood Khan jointly met the Chief Adviser during the visit.
Prior to the meeting, Professor Yunus paid homage to the fallen heroes of the Bangladesh Armed Forces who made the supreme sacrifice during the Liberation War of 1971. He placed a wreath at the Shikha Anirban memorial, paying deep respects to the martyrs.
The courtesy meeting was held as part of the day’s formal programmes honouring the contributions, sacrifice, and legacy of the country’s armed forces.
